When Not To Take Up a Category for Strategic Sourcing

Empowering CPO

To answer this question, it is much simpler first to list down the reasons as to when a specific category should be taken up for Strategic Sourcing. Ideally on an ongoing basis an organization should conduct Spend Analysis and Opportunity Assessment. Once every year is the right frequency. This helps a procurement organization to list down its plan for the New Year and identify categories that should be taken up for sourcing.
